Jessica Alba is a Big Winner at the 2012 Environmental Media Awards

Jessica Alba has made major waves in the environmental community over the last year with her business venture The Honest Company, and she was handsomely rewarded for those efforts over the weekend.

The 31-year-old actress received the EMA Green Parent Award at the 2012 Environmental Media Awards on Saturday night at Warner Brothers Studios in Burbank.

Other winners included Malin Akerman, Ian Somerhalder and entrepreneur Elon Musk.

A list of the winners is included below:

 

EMA Lifetime Achievement Award
Kelly Meyer

EMA Corporate Responsibility Award
Elon Musk

EMA Green Parent Award
Jessica Alba

EMA Futures Award
Ian Somerhalder

Feature Film
The Lorax

Documentary
Chasing Ice

Television Episodic Comedy
Veep “Frozen Yogurt”

Television Episodic Drama
Dallas “Pilot: Changing of the Guard”

Reality Television
Superfish: Bluefin Tuna

Children’s Television
Handy Manny “Beach Clean-up”
